⚡ UPDATE: July 4th, 2026 — The Most Important Deadline in Illinois Solar


Since we published this post, the solar landscape in Illinois has shifted dramatically — and the window for maximum savings just got a hard deadline.


On July 4, 2026, the last federal investment tax credit for commercial solar projects expires. The Section 48E commercial ITC still offers a 30% tax credit — but only if construction begins before July 4, 2026. After that date, this credit disappears entirely.


But here’s what makes right now extraordinary: while the federal government pulled back, Illinois did the opposite. The Illinois Shines program increased SREC payouts by 34 to 43 percent for the 2026–2027 program year. That means homeowners and businesses can now recover 20 to 30 percent of their total system cost through SRECs — the highest levels Illinois has ever offered.


What This Means for Homeowners


Even though the federal residential credit (Section 25D) expired at the end of 2025, Illinois homeowners now benefit from record-high state incentives. Combined with full net metering credits, ComEd battery rebates up to 00 per kWh, and our Pure Power Promo, the payback window on a residential solar installation has never been shorter in Illinois. The economics are better now than when the federal credit existed.
